Skip to content

[opt](build) move some class into common package#61580

Open
morrySnow wants to merge 1 commit intoapache:masterfrom
morrySnow:move_to_common
Open

[opt](build) move some class into common package#61580
morrySnow wants to merge 1 commit intoapache:masterfrom
morrySnow:move_to_common

Conversation

@morrySnow
Copy link
Contributor

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@morrySnow
Copy link
Contributor Author

run buildall

@Thearas
Copy link
Contributor

Thearas commented Mar 20, 2026

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@doris-robot
Copy link

TPC-H: Total hot run time: 27215 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it da345cf514be9194b18de11ea63ff267e1351d27, data reload: false

------ Round 1 ----------------------------------
orders	Doris	NULL	NULL	0	0	0	NULL	0	NULL	NULL	2023-12-26 18:27:23	2023-12-26 18:42:55	NULL	utf-8	NULL	NULL	
============================================
q1	17627	4649	4362	4362
q2	q3	10643	850	528	528
q4	4671	360	254	254
q5	7583	1207	1010	1010
q6	177	174	143	143
q7	789	829	683	683
q8	9879	1478	1353	1353
q9	5546	4730	4681	4681
q10	6341	1929	1635	1635
q11	475	261	243	243
q12	753	600	467	467
q13	18053	2949	2168	2168
q14	232	228	209	209
q15	q16	731	753	676	676
q17	748	811	468	468
q18	5882	5394	5369	5369
q19	1104	986	636	636
q20	548	496	376	376
q21	4629	1898	1674	1674
q22	428	353	280	280
Total cold run time: 96839 ms
Total hot run time: 27215 ms

----- Round 2, with runtime_filter_mode=off -----
orders	Doris	NULL	NULL	150000000	42	6422171781	NULL	22778155	NULL	NULL	2023-12-26 18:27:23	2023-12-26 18:42:55	NULL	utf-8	NULL	NULL	
============================================
q1	4755	4535	4687	4535
q2	q3	4047	4324	3847	3847
q4	866	1212	767	767
q5	4053	4464	4318	4318
q6	190	187	141	141
q7	1783	1701	1588	1588
q8	2540	2745	2553	2553
q9	7590	7320	7384	7320
q10	3862	3958	3698	3698
q11	524	441	435	435
q12	505	610	498	498
q13	2852	3227	2404	2404
q14	273	301	278	278
q15	q16	719	750	713	713
q17	1155	1450	1417	1417
q18	7187	6808	6659	6659
q19	885	889	956	889
q20	2084	2188	1968	1968
q21	3982	3506	3415	3415
q22	463	445	389	389
Total cold run time: 50315 ms
Total hot run time: 47832 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 168794 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it da345cf514be9194b18de11ea63ff267e1351d27, data reload: false

query5	4354	642	501	501
query6	339	238	217	217
query7	4215	478	277	277
query8	347	259	233	233
query9	8749	2719	2735	2719
query10	535	429	362	362
query11	6931	5082	4856	4856
query12	187	131	125	125
query13	1289	475	353	353
query14	5722	3782	3496	3496
query14_1	2879	2857	2827	2827
query15	205	196	181	181
query16	985	482	471	471
query17	902	743	641	641
query18	2460	455	351	351
query19	243	213	189	189
query20	138	128	130	128
query21	215	133	112	112
query22	13263	14080	14523	14080
query23	16157	15763	15750	15750
query23_1	15800	15555	15402	15402
query24	7128	1597	1225	1225
query24_1	1216	1245	1228	1228
query25	550	470	410	410
query26	1280	267	159	159
query27	2762	485	301	301
query28	4466	1839	1807	1807
query29	862	583	480	480
query30	298	221	191	191
query31	990	957	874	874
query32	81	72	72	72
query33	516	358	286	286
query34	875	880	516	516
query35	630	683	590	590
query36	1114	1098	979	979
query37	141	98	86	86
query38	2972	2956	2916	2916
query39	864	847	828	828
query39_1	784	795	783	783
query40	228	159	133	133
query41	64	63	59	59
query42	264	257	257	257
query43	244	256	228	228
query44	
query45	199	187	185	185
query46	871	991	605	605
query47	2082	2122	2047	2047
query48	313	316	227	227
query49	627	469	394	394
query50	704	272	219	219
query51	4064	4068	3970	3970
query52	263	267	258	258
query53	287	335	296	296
query54	311	280	280	280
query55	96	88	84	84
query56	342	329	313	313
query57	1948	1821	1743	1743
query58	291	299	264	264
query59	2770	2948	2745	2745
query60	342	345	331	331
query61	161	153	156	153
query62	625	588	533	533
query63	312	290	282	282
query64	5032	1283	1013	1013
query65	
query66	1478	446	360	360
query67	24240	24375	24252	24252
query68	
query69	405	315	290	290
query70	938	965	963	963
query71	343	315	307	307
query72	2882	2678	2468	2468
query73	544	562	323	323
query74	9610	9566	9362	9362
query75	2858	2769	2529	2529
query76	2289	1059	702	702
query77	386	397	331	331
query78	10901	11066	10473	10473
query79	2397	803	612	612
query80	1747	701	576	576
query81	551	260	222	222
query82	991	156	118	118
query83	338	271	248	248
query84	296	120	103	103
query85	899	510	454	454
query86	431	338	297	297
query87	3183	3096	3044	3044
query88	3602	2671	2653	2653
query89	440	374	341	341
query90	2013	185	184	184
query91	166	165	136	136
query92	77	74	75	74
query93	1034	861	501	501
query94	646	305	302	302
query95	598	354	341	341
query96	644	532	235	235
query97	2463	2453	2387	2387
query98	245	229	234	229
query99	1003	1009	887	887
Total cold run time: 250752 ms
Total hot run time: 168794 ms

@hello-stephen
Copy link
Contributor

FE UT Coverage Report

Increment line coverage 32.00% (8/25) 🎉
Increment coverage report
Complete coverage report

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ants